自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(22)
  • 收藏
  • 关注

原创 hadoop伪分布式的搭建案例

hadoop伪分布式的搭建环境准备centos环境准备配置静态ipssh免密登录关闭防火墙java环境准备hadoop环境准备hadoop伪分布式配置修改配置文件core-site.xmlhdfs-site.xmlyarn-site.xmlmaped-site.xml启动及初始化测试案例可能会存在的问题第二次hadoop启动不成功环境准备linux版本:centos7.2 64centos环境准备配置静态ip##通过修改配置文件设置静态ipvim /etc/sysconfig/network-

2020-09-16 16:05:31 325

原创 Java获取当天0时0分0秒时间的方法

Java获取当天0点时间时间戳转时分秒

2022-06-29 19:56:29 1983 1

原创 C语言写的一个简单日历。

好久没有写C了~#include <stdio.h>#include <stdlib.h>int months[12] = {31,28,31,30,31,30,31,31,30,31,30,31}; void init(){ system("date");}//判断是否为闰年int JudgeRunnian(int year){ //可以同时被4整除和不能被100整除 return year%4==0&&year%10

2021-12-06 00:11:07 238

原创 Oralce19c 数据库安装教程 附带下载地址

系统镜像名称:OracleLinux-R7-U9-Server-x86_64下载地址:https://yum.oracle.com/ISOS/OracleLinux/OL7/u9/x86_64/OracleLinux-R7-U9-Server-x86_64-dvd.isolinux安装方法可以参考这篇博文 操作系统类型和镜像换成oracle linux 即可https://blog.csdn.net/DRAGON_ranhou/article/details/104637031数据库版本:Oracle

2021-08-30 16:46:08 722

原创 JavaSrcipt 五子棋

HTML部分<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<title>五子棋</title> <style> * { padding: 0; margin: 0; } body{ padding-top: 100px;

2020-10-25 19:45:36 263

原创 蓝桥杯 身份证的奥秘

1、号码的结构公民身份号码是特征组合码,由十七位数字本体码和一位校验码组成。排列顺序从左至右依次为:六位数字地址码,八位数字出生日期码,三位数字顺序码和一位数字校验码。2、地址码表示编码对象常住户口所在县(市、旗、区)的行政区划代码,按GB / T2260的规定执行。3、出生日期码表示编码对象出生的年、月、日,按GB / T7408的规定执行,年、月、日代码之间不用分隔符。4、顺序码...

2020-09-30 13:57:47 1391 4

原创 C语言-实现输入的日期判断当天为星期几

思路:1900年1月1日为星期一#define _CRT_SECURE_NO_WARNINGS#include <stdio.h>void jisuanrq(int &year,int &month,int &day,char *time) //将字符串转换为整数日期{ int l = 0; year = 0; month = 0; day ...

2020-09-30 13:57:32 5131

原创 JAVAswing实现贪吃蛇

//游戏主体package com.anlong.贪吃蛇;import javax.swing.*;import java.awt.*;import java.awt.event.*;/** * @author bujiasisuo * @create 2020-05-09-10:18 * @Version 1.0 * 功能:贪吃蛇小游戏 * 蛇的身体位置存放在数组中,移动即只改变第一个,数组元素以此后移。 * 通过实现ActionListener接口使用时钟事件 * new T

2020-09-24 08:24:20 176

原创 C语言-魔术师发牌问题的一种写法

#include <stdio.h>#include <malloc.h>typedef struct Node{ int data; Node* next;}*link;void init(link *lt){ link t,p; t = (link)malloc(sizeof(Node)); t->data = 0; *lt = t;...

2020-09-23 09:58:28 342

原创 C语言实现维吉尼亚密码加密解密

为了生成密码,需要使用表格法。这一表格(如图1所示)包括了26行字母表,每一行都由前一行向左偏移一位得到。具体使用哪一行字母表进行编译是基于密钥进行的,在过程中会不断地变换。例如,假设明文为:ATTACKATDAWN选择某一关键词并重复而得到密钥,如关键词为LEMON时,密钥为:LEMONLEMONLE对于明文的第一个字母A,对应密钥的第一个字母L,于是使用表格中L行字母表进行加密,得...

2020-09-23 09:58:12 2397

原创 C++基于后缀(逆波兰)表达式实现的简单计算器

#include <iostream>#include <string>#include <stack>using namespace std;int pdyxj(char c) //判断符号优先级{ int t; switch (c) { case '+':t = 1; break; case '-':t = 1; break;...

2020-09-23 09:57:57 400

原创 C++递归解决汉诺塔问题 ,以及大概思路

汉诺塔的问题考验的是对递归思想的理解。建议找一张A4纸,将其中的关系一层层的写出来,然后从底层向回捋。#include <iostream>#include <string>#include <stack>using namespace std;/*void Hnt(int n,char a,char b,char c){ if (n == ...

2020-09-23 09:57:34 267

原创 C++递归解决八皇后问题的大概思路

思路:通过已有皇后判断哪些位置需要还可以放置,主要是判断三个方向左右 左上 右上。建议:先尝试写出一种结果,然后在进行扩展。画一张图的话有利于更加清晰的分析。#include <iostream>#include <string>using namespace std;int que = 0;int Noemp(int (*chess)[8],int...

2020-09-23 09:57:22 329

原创 C语言实现拉丁方阵

拉丁方阵是一种 n × n 的方阵,在这种 n × n 的方阵里,恰有 n 种不同的元素,每一种不同的元素在同一行或同一列里只出现一次。#define _CRT_SECURE_NO_WARNINGS#include <stdio.h>#include <malloc.h>typedef struct Node{ int data; Node* next;...

2020-09-23 09:57:08 969 2

原创 BF(暴力)算法

0x01 BF算法简介BF算法是用于在A字符串寻找B字符串的一种算法,正如它的名字一样,是一个很暴力的算法。0x02 暴力的体现为啥说BF这个算法暴力呢,不单单是因为名字,最主要的是体现在处理字符串的方式上。举个栗子。位置012345678字符串Acabcabxbc字符串Babx如果让BF算法从A串中寻找...

2020-09-23 09:56:31 702

原创 KMP算法

0x01 KMP算法简介KMP算法是一种高效寻找字符串的算法,用于在字符串A中是否存在字符串B,时间复杂度为O(n+m)。0x02 KMP

2020-09-23 09:56:17 211 3

原创 JAVA基础知识(一)未完待续~

JAVA基础知识文章目录JAVA基础知识相关术语设置JAVA环境变量win版linux版JAVA命令JAVA程序设计基础一个简单的Java 程序Java编程规范注释数据类型整形浮点型char型boolean类型变量变量命名规则变量的初始化常量JAVA白皮书的关键术语: 简单性、面向对象、分布式、健壮性、安全性、体系结构中立、可移植性、解释型、高性能、多线程、动态性。相关术语术语名...

2020-09-23 09:54:57 241

原创 javaIO流超全总结(未完待续)

javaIO流File类File类简介File类的使用预备知识File类的实例化获取文件信息获取绝对路径获取路径获取文件名称获取上层目录路径获取文件大小获取最后一次文件修改时间获取指定目录下所有文件或文件目录的名称(String 数组)获取指定目录下所有文件或文件目录的名称(File 数组)判断文件信息是否是文件目录是否是文件文件是否存在文件是否可读文件是否可写文件是否隐藏创建修改文件创建文件创建文件目录删除文件移动文件综合案例IO流预备知识字符流FileReaderFileWriter综合案例-文本文件的

2020-09-23 09:51:05 152

原创 HDFS文件系统(含hdfs常用命令,java对hdfs API的简单操作)

HDFS文件系统HDFS概念什么是HDFSHDFS的组成HDFS文件块大小HFDS命令行操作基本语法常用命令Java操作hdfs配置编译环境获取文件系统上传文件文件下载目录创建删除文件文件重命名前置条件:hadoop环境搭建完毕。hadoop环境搭建HDFS概念什么是HDFSHDFS,它是一个文件系统,用于存储文件,通过目录树来定位文件;其次,它是分布式的,由很多服务器联合起来实现其功能,集群中的服务器有各自的角色。HDFS的设计适合一次写入,多次读出的场景,且不支持文件的修改。适合用来做数据

2020-09-18 15:54:34 249 1

原创 Centos7的安装过程-图文(附VMtools的安装) 超详细。

Centos7镜像下载地址:http://isoredirect.centos.org/centos/8-stream/isos/x86_64/软件准备:VMware Workstation 15(10版本以以上都可以)Centos7镜像安装步骤1.创建一个新的虚拟机0x01新建虚拟机,选择经典版本即可。0x02下一步,选择创建一个空白硬盘。0x03根据需要选择操作系统...

2020-09-16 16:09:26 542

原创 MySql基础命令详解(基础篇)

MySql学习笔记(基础篇)-MySql基础命令详解目录MySql学习笔记(基础篇)-MySql基础命令详解环境介绍Sql的分类DDL语句对库的操作对表的操作DML语言插入记录更新记录删除记录查询记录MySql语法规范环境介绍Centos7MySql5.7Sql的分类Sql,分为DQL(查询),DML(修改),DDL(管理),TCL(事物的处理)。**DDL语句:**数据定义语句...

2020-03-21 11:56:11 1163

原创 MySql安装与基础配置(基础篇)

MySql学习笔记-mysql安装与基础设置环境介绍Centos7MySql5.7MySql5.7的安装卸载默认数据库 mariadbrpm -qa | grep mariadb //列出所有被安装的rpm packageyum -y remove mariadb //卸载mariadb相关的rpm package安装方法1 — tar包安装下载与解压...

2020-03-18 09:23:54 346

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除